About City of Sault Ste. Marie

Located on the shore of the St. Marys River in Northern Ontario, connecting Lake Huron and Lake Superior, the city is at the heart of the Great Lakes and reachable through the Trans Canada Highway from the east and west.


The city is close to the US-Canada border to the south and an international bridge connects it to Sault Ste. Marie, Michigan through Interstate 75. Its unique location attracts business, trade, and travelers. With deep industrial roots, Sault Ste. Marie is a leading producer of steel, forestry products, and renewable energy. Other key sectors for the city include ICT & digital, clean tech, lottery and gaming, and aviation.